Title: Now — Yes, Now — Is the Time for Contingent Faculty to Organize
*Authors: * Josh Brahinsky and Roxi Power
*Source:* Chronicle of Higher Education
*Date:* April 24, 2020
*Summary: *Long before the virus, uncertainty was a given for contingent faculty https://www.chronicle.com/article/The-Great-Shame-of-Our/239148. Many of us have little sense of our next teaching gig. We can barely sign a lease, let alone get a loan on a house. Yet, averaged across all higher-ed institutions, we’re responsible for teaching the majority https://www.chronicle.com/article/The-University-Is-a-Ticking/246119 of college courses.
